The very time I didnt take Joe to the docs he ended up with something called Henoch Shonlin purpura.
Its not common but is even less common in girls. It stemmed from a viral infection he had (which he always seems to get). It started as a rash on his legs which wouldnt blanch so we were sent to hospital and didnt get out for 3 days in which they took bloods and we narrowly avoided a lumbar puncture. Even now I have to check his pee for protiens and blood (with a wee stick). Im glad he will sit on jessicas potty.
If I had taken him to the docs when his cold started and insisted on something/ treatment then this may have been prevented. Maybe not, but dont ever feel worried about bothering your doc.
